Ramban, DD, A powerful storm accompanied by heavy rainfall lashed Ramban last night, causing widespread damage across the region. Several trees were uprooted, falling on vehicles parked along the roadside. Preliminary reports indicate that numerous private vehicles, the local Community Hall, and several Government buildings have sustained significant damage.
Sanjay Verma, a local resident, said, “It was terrifying. Around midnight, the wind was so strong that we could hear trees crashing down. We’ve never seen anything like this before in recent years.”
Virender Singh, another resident, shared, “Several cars, including mine, have been badly damaged. We urge the administration to expedite relief efforts and assess losses promptly.”
vinod Kumar Range Officer Ramban, confirmed, “We are conducting a survey of the damaged structures. Restoration work has begun and our priority is to ensure public safety and resume normalcy as quickly as possible.”
Authorities have urged citizens to remain cautious and avoid venturing into storm-hit areas until cleanup operations are complete.DD
